Written by AARON CASTREJON CityWatch Editor ROSEMEAD – Sheriff’s detectives revealed Friday that a missing teen is being sought as a person of interest in a fatal hit and run collision.
Detectives with the Los Angeles County Sheriff’s Temple Station are looking for 16-year-old Mariano Coc, who is possibly involved in the collision between a black 2009 Nissan Altima and a 61-year-old pedestrian on San Gabriel Boulevard south of Garvey Avenue November 8. The victim died from his injuries days later, detectives said. Coc has been missing from his South El Monte home since Sunday, November 7. It is unclear if he is the driver of the Altima. The crash occurred around 10:38 a.m. Lt. Moen of the Sheriff’s Temple Station said initially that two vehicles collided and that the 61-year-old man exited his vehicle to speak with the Altima driver, the latter struck the man and drove away from the scene. The Nissan Altima was found abandoned. Detectives will hold a press conference to distribute the teen’s missing persons flyer. “Detectives will ask for any information leading to Mariano’s whereabouts, as he could possibly be a potential victim of another crime or might have information about the fatal hit and run incident,” according to the Los Angeles County Sheriff’s Department in a written statement. Written by AARON CASTREJON CityWatch Editor ROSEMEAD - Deputies are still searching for the driver of a vehicle that struck and critically wounded another person after a two-vehicle collision November 8.
The two-vehicle collision occurred in the area of San Gabriel Boulevard and Garvey Avenue around 10:38 a.m. Monday morning. One driver exited his vehicle to speak with the other driver, the latter struck and critically wounded the first driver during an escape, according to Lt. Moen of the Los Angeles County Sheriff’s Temple Station. The critically-wounded driver was taken to County/USC Medical Center. Deputies did locate the suspect’s abandoned vehicle, described as a possible black Nissan Altima with a grey bumper, Moen told SGV CityWatch. Moen did not known where the suspect’s vehicle was located. No suspect description was available. |
